ABOUT THE BIRD SPECIES...

The Common Potoo, Grey Potoo or Lesser Potoo (Nyctibius griseus), is a nocturnal bird which breeds in tropical Central and South America from Nicaragua to northern Argentina and northern Uruguay. The Northern Potoo (N. jamaicensis) was formerly classified as a subspecies of this species.

This potoo is a large cypselomorph bird related to the nightjars and frogmouths.

It is a resident breeder in open woodlands and savannah.

This nocturnal insectivore hunts from a perch like a shrike or flycatcher.
